The Underwriting Coordinator supports the day-to-day operational effectiveness of the Underwriting department. This role is responsible for workforce coordination, scheduling, resource allocation, operational reporting, and administrative support for a team of more than 90 underwriting professionals. The Underwriting Coordinator monitors staffing requirements, maintains workforce management systems, supports departmental planning activities, and provides timely operational information that enables leaders to effectively manage workload, productivity, and service delivery.


How you will create impact: 
  • Coordinate staffing, scheduling, and resource allocation activities to support operational effectiveness across the Underwriting department.
  • Monitor schedule adherence, workforce coverage, and operational demands while identifying and escalating potential staffing or service gaps.
  • Maintain workforce management and telephony systems, including employee profiles, skills, workgroups, and reporting requirements.
  • Generate, analyze, and distribute operational and productivity reports to support business decision-making.
  • Coordinate departmental meetings, events, vacation planning, and other administrative activities.
  • Collaborate with leaders, Workforce Management, Information Technology, and Telephony teams to support operational performance and resolve issues impacting service delivery.
  • Maintain confidential employee and operational information while ensuring information is shared only with authorized stakeholders
  • Support budget administration activities through expense review and reconciliation processes.

To join our team:  
  • Completion of post-secondary education.
  • Minimum 2 years of experience in an administrative or workforce coordination role.
  • Experience with scheduling and resource management in a service-oriented environment.
  •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Excel, including creating and maintaining complex spreadsheets and reports.
  • Strong organ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to exercise sound judgment, solve problems independently, and maintain a high level of accuracy.
  • Ability to handle sensitive and confidential information with discretion.
  • Knowledge of workforce management or call centre scheduling systems is considered an asset.
  • Experience working with GENESYS or similar telephony/workforce management platforms is considered an asset.
